Meaning & usage

name
  1. A surname.

    countable · uncountable
  2. A unisex given name.

    countable · uncountable
  3. A placename: A place in England: A large village and civil parish on the Isle of Wight (OS grid ref SZ5983).

    countable · uncountable
  4. A placename: A place in England: A settlement in Wilsford cum Lake parish, Wiltshire (OS grid ref SU1339).

    countable · uncountable
  5.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Fremont County, Idaho.

    countable · uncountable
  6.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Laurel County, Kentucky.

    countable · uncountable
  7.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Ascension Parish, Louisiana.

    countable · uncountable
  8.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Baltimore County, Maryland.

    countable · uncountable
  9.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Garfield Township, Clare County, Michigan.

    countable · uncountable
  10. A placename: A number of places in the United States: A town in Newton County and Scott County, Mississippi.

    countable · uncountable
  11.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Tulsa County, Oklahoma.

    countable · uncountable
  12.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Northumberland County, Virginia.

    countable · uncountable
  13. A placename: A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in Logan County, West Virginia.

    countable · uncountable
  14. A placename: A number of places in the United States: A town in Marinette County, Wisconsin.

    countable · uncountable
  15. A placename: A number of places in the United States: A former town in Milwaukee County, Wisconsin, annexed by the city of Milwaukee in 1954.

    countable · uncountable
  16. A placename: A number of places in the United States: A town in Price County, Wisconsin.

    countable · uncountable
  17. A placename: A number of places in the United States: A number of townships, listed under Lake Township.

    countable · uncountable
Where this word comes from

Derived from the noun lake.
